    When I create a route and add a pause for coffe or lunch it is calculated right in the web version.
    However, when I start to navigate with the app on my Android phone the time isn't calculated in the timeline.

    So in the web version I make a route of say 2:53 and add a pause of 30 mins.
    The total time goes up to 3:23.
    When navigating the route on my phone with the app it stays 2:53.

    Is there a setting I am missing or is this a bug in the app or in combination with my device?

        @Alex-79 That's exactly how it works! In the route planner, you can schedule breaks. These are never included in your actual route. When you start the route, your navigation system doesn't know when or how long you'll take that scheduled break, right? In the planner, it's just an indication of how long you'll be on the road that day. Once you've reached your planned break point and get back on the road after 30 minutes, the remaining route time will be adjusted accordingly, depending on how long you actually stopped. Maybe instead of 30 minutes, you stopped for 45 minutes. In that case, your "planned time" wouldn't be accurate anymore either.

          The pause will only appear, if you export a gpx1.2 to a Garmin Zumo. Than pausetime is added to the routetime, so you can exactly tell your wife, when she can start preparing dinner 😉
